Cell Culture: In cell tradition techniques, pipettes are useful for including or eliminating modest volumes of lifestyle medium, making certain even distribution of crucial nutrients for cell progress.

A multichannel pipette is akin to one-channel pipette, besides it might hold many tips concurrently. The liquid is aspirated at the same get more info time through the identical effectively into a variety of channels.

Mohr pipettes and serological pipettes are The 2 primary types of graduated pipettes.

The narrow neck of those pipettes allows much more exact readings in the meniscus, ensuring the precise delivery of answers and minimizing measurement faults for reliable benefits.

Lots of people wrongly think that it is always exact at any quantity. in fact, the accuracy can change according to just how much liquid is applied. Also, drawing up liquid also rapidly or unevenly can influence accuracy. So, using the right techniques is vital to obtain accurate outcomes.
